About Duty Rates: Rates are divided into Column 1 and Column 2. Column 1 is subdivided into General (normal trade relations rates for all countries not eligible for special programs) and Special (preferential rates for countries with free trade agreements or preference programs). Column 2 rates apply to products from Cuba, North Korea, Belarus, and Russia. When no special rate exists for a classification, General rates apply.

Overview

This classification covers centrifugal liquid chilling refrigerating units, also known as centrifugal chillers. These are self-contained mechanical refrigeration systems that utilize a centrifugal compressor to cool a liquid, typically water or a water-glycol mixture. They are primarily used in large-scale cooling applications, such as air conditioning for commercial buildings, industrial processes requiring precise temperature control, and data center cooling. The defining characteristic is the use of centrifugal force within the compressor mechanism for the refrigeration cycle.

Distinguishing this category from its siblings, 8418.69.01.40 specifically enumerates units employing a centrifugal compressor. This differentiates them from icemaking machines (8418.69.01.10), drinking water coolers (8418.69.01.20), and soda fountain/beer dispensing equipment (8418.69.01.30), which have distinct functions and designs. Furthermore, it is separate from other types of liquid chilling units such as reciprocating (8418.69.01.50) and absorption (8418.69.01.60) chillers, which utilize different compression technologies.

As a leaf node, this classification does not have further subdivisions. Therefore, its scope is precisely defined by the type of refrigeration unit described. Classification within this category hinges on the presence of a centrifugal compressor and its function in chilling liquids for broader cooling purposes, differentiating it from other refrigerating equipment based on compressor type or primary application.
